SouthWest Edgecombe and North Lenoir squared off in some playoff action on Tuesday, but SouthWest Edgecombe had to settle for second. They came up short against the Hawks, falling 19-4. For those keeping track at home, that's the biggest loss the Cougars have suffered since March 14th.
Mackenzie Moore made the most of her time at bat despite the final result and went a perfect 2-for-2 with one home run and two RBI.

SouthWest Edgecombe moved to 13-6 with that defeat, which also ended their four-game winning streak. As for North Lenoir, they are on a roll lately: they've won eight of their last nine games. That's provided a nice bump to their 15-3 record this season.
SouthWest Edgecombe does not have any more games scheduled as of now. As for North Lenoir, they will square off against Roanoke Rapids on Friday. The Hawks' pitchers better be ready for this one: the Yellowjackets have averaged an impressive 7.1 runs per game this season.
